#ea9352 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ea9352 is composed of 91.8% red, 57.6%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.2% magenta, 65%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 25.7 degrees, a saturation of 78.4% and a lightness of 62%. #ea9352 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a4 with #d52700.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

#ea9352 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ea9352 has RGB values of R:234, G:147,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.65,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15373138.
